The fund seeks to achieve its objective by investing principally in debt instruments of Sovereigns and Quasi-Sovereigns of Emerging Market Countries and EM Supra-Nationalsdenominated principally in Hard Currencies. The fund has no restrictions on individual security duration. More on Ashmore Emerging Markets
